Description
Adding
export.fishwhich does the same asexport.shjust for fish-shell. The provided solution in #1206 didn't work for me as after runningbash -c "source export.shdidn't setESP_MATTER_PATHthus building didn't workRelated
Fixes #1206
Testing
Tested both
source export.fishandsource ~/esp-matter/export.fishand compiled an example afterwards successfully.Checklist
